The Fierce Reaper H-Tac 7MM BC Tungsten 22″ Carbon Barrel is a bolt-action rifle built for hunters who need to reach out and touch game at long range without hauling a boat anchor up the mountain. Chambered in 7MM Backcountry, this rig pairs a lightweight C3 carbon fiber barrel with a rigid carbon/aluminum chassis. It’s drilled and tapped for optics, threaded for brakes or suppressors, and finished in tough Tungsten Cerakote. For the hunter who demands precision without the weight penalty, this rifle delivers.

Key Features

  • C3 Carbon Fiber Barrel – The 22-inch carbon-wrapped barrel sheds weight while maintaining stiffness for consistent accuracy shot after shot. This matters when you’re hiking miles into elk country and every ounce counts.
  • Tungsten Cerakote Finish – Corrosion- and scratch-resistant coating that stands up to rain, snow, and rough handling. You can trust this finish to hold up through a wet week in the backcountry.
  • 700-Pattern Receiver – Drilled and tapped for standard Remington 700 scope bases and triggers, so you can mount your preferred optics and aftermarket triggers without gunsmithing. That means less hassle and more time on the mountain.
  • M-LOK Forearm – Full-length M-LOK slots let you attach bipods, sling mounts, or night vision gear exactly where you need them. This is critical for building a versatile hunting rig that adapts to different hunts.
  • Threaded Muzzle – The barrel is threaded for muzzle brakes or suppressors, reducing recoil and noise. For Western hunters chasing mule deer or pronghorn, this keeps your shot placement precise during follow-ups.

Pros & Cons

  • Pro: Sub-7-pound weight makes it a dream to carry all day. Con: The carbon barrel can heat up faster than a steel barrel during rapid fire strings, so it’s not ideal for high-volume range sessions.
  • Pro: 7MM Backcountry offers flat trajectory and retained energy at extended ranges. Con: Ammo availability is still limited compared to mainstream calibers like .308 or 6.5 Creedmoor.
  • Pro: Excellent build quality from Fierce Firearms, a brand known for precision hunting rifles. Con: The price point is higher than some entry-level long-range rifles.

FAQ

What scope base pattern does the Fierce Reaper H-TAC use?

It uses the Remington 700 short-action pattern, so any standard 700 base or rail will fit. This gives you tons of aftermarket options from brands like Seekins, Nightforce, or Leupold.

Is the barrel threaded for a suppressor?

Yes, the 22″ C3 carbon barrel is threaded 5/8-24, which is common for .30-caliber suppressors and brakes. Just make sure your can is rated for the 7MM Backcountry cartridge.

How accurate is the Fierce Reaper H-TAC out of the box?

According to Fierce Firearms specs, the Reaper H-TAC is guaranteed to shoot sub-MOA with quality factory ammunition. Many owners report consistent 0.5-0.75 MOA groups at 100 yards.

Can I swap the trigger on this rifle?

Yes, the 700-pattern receiver accepts any Remington 700-style trigger, including popular upgrades from Timney, TriggerTech, and Geissele. This lets you tune the pull weight to your preference.

What bipod works best with the M-LOK forearm?

Any M-LOK bipod will attach directly, like the Atlas BT46 or Harris S-BRM with an M-LOK adapter. You can also use a picatinny adapter if you prefer.
